Definitions
Noun
- 1 Lack of restraint; the quality of being unrestrained. uncountable, usually
"His bluntly effective touring cohort — the guitarist Robin Finck, the bassist Justin Meldal-Johnsen and the drummer Ilan Rubin — gave him all the power he could use, surging and thrashing with deceptive unrestraint."
- 2 the quality of lacking restraint wordnet

Etymology
From un- + restraint.
